所有數(shù)字化產(chǎn)品










在當(dāng)今快節(jié)奏的軟件開(kāi)發(fā)環(huán)境中,開(kāi)發(fā)人員不斷尋求能夠提高生產(chǎn)力和代碼質(zhì)量的工具和方法。cursor作為一款新興的代碼編輯器,以其強(qiáng)大的功能和用戶友好的界面,迅速在開(kāi)發(fā)者社區(qū)中獲得了關(guān)注。本文將探討如何通過(guò)cursor進(jìn)行代碼優(yōu)化,從而提升開(kāi)發(fā)效率和代碼質(zhì)量。
代碼編輯器的選擇對(duì)開(kāi)發(fā)效率有直接影響。cursor提供了智能代碼補(bǔ)全、語(yǔ)法高亮和錯(cuò)誤檢測(cè)等功能,這些功能幫助開(kāi)發(fā)者減少打字錯(cuò)誤并加快編碼速度。cursor支持多種編程語(yǔ)言,使其成為多語(yǔ)言開(kāi)發(fā)項(xiàng)目的理想選擇。通過(guò)合理配置cursor,開(kāi)發(fā)者可以創(chuàng)建一個(gè)高度定制化的編碼環(huán)境,滿足特定項(xiàng)目的需求。
代碼重構(gòu)是優(yōu)化代碼結(jié)構(gòu)的重要步驟。cursor內(nèi)置的重構(gòu)工具允許開(kāi)發(fā)者安全地重命名變量、提取方法和內(nèi)聯(lián)變量,而無(wú)需手動(dòng)修改大量代碼。這不僅減少了人為錯(cuò)誤的風(fēng)險(xiǎn),還節(jié)省了寶貴的時(shí)間。使用cursor的重構(gòu)功能,可以輕松地將重復(fù)代碼段提取為獨(dú)立函數(shù),提高代碼的可讀性和可維護(hù)性。
調(diào)試和測(cè)試是確保代碼質(zhì)量的關(guān)鍵環(huán)節(jié)。cursor與多種調(diào)試器和測(cè)試框架集成,提供了無(wú)縫的調(diào)試體驗(yàn)。開(kāi)發(fā)者可以在cursor中設(shè)置斷點(diǎn)、檢查變量值和單步執(zhí)行代碼,從而快速定位和修復(fù)錯(cuò)誤。cursor支持運(yùn)行單元測(cè)試和集成測(cè)試,幫助團(tuán)隊(duì)在早期發(fā)現(xiàn)潛在問(wèn)題,減少后期修復(fù)的成本。
版本控制是現(xiàn)代軟件開(kāi)發(fā)的核心。cursor與Git等版本控制系統(tǒng)緊密集成,允許開(kāi)發(fā)者直接在編輯器中提交代碼、查看差異和解決沖突。這簡(jiǎn)化了版本管理流程,使團(tuán)隊(duì)協(xié)作更加高效。通過(guò)cursor的版本控制功能,開(kāi)發(fā)者可以更好地跟蹤代碼變更,確保代碼庫(kù)的穩(wěn)定性和一致性。
性能優(yōu)化是提升應(yīng)用響應(yīng)速度和資源利用率的重要手段。cursor提供了性能分析工具,幫助開(kāi)發(fā)者識(shí)別代碼中的瓶頸。通過(guò)cursor的性能分析器,可以監(jiān)測(cè)函數(shù)執(zhí)行時(shí)間和內(nèi)存使用情況,從而優(yōu)化關(guān)鍵代碼段。cursor支持代碼壓縮和打包,減少終產(chǎn)品的體積,提升加載速度。
cursor作為一款功能豐富的代碼編輯器,通過(guò)其智能編輯、重構(gòu)工具、調(diào)試集成、版本控制和性能優(yōu)化功能,顯著提升了開(kāi)發(fā)效率和代碼質(zhì)量。 adopting cursor into your workflow can lead to more maintainable, efficient, and error-free code, ultimately contributing to the success of software projects.
相關(guān)TAG標(biāo)簽:代碼質(zhì)量 cursor代碼優(yōu)化 開(kāi)發(fā)效率 代碼重構(gòu) 性能優(yōu)化
欄目: 華萬(wàn)新聞
2025-09-18
欄目: 華萬(wàn)新聞
2025-09-18
欄目: 華萬(wàn)新聞
2025-09-18
欄目: 華萬(wàn)新聞
2025-09-18
欄目: 華萬(wàn)新聞
2025-09-18
欄目: 華萬(wàn)新聞
2025-09-18
5000款臻選科技產(chǎn)品,期待您的免費(fèi)試用!
立即試用